Overview

Jake represents a wide range of financial services companies in disputes, litigation, investigations, and examinations. He focuses his practice on defending consumer facing financial institutions against class actions and individual claims in both state and federal courts, particularly with respect to the “alphabet soup” of consumer protection statutes, including the Fair Credit Reporting Act (FCRA), Fair Debt Collection Practices Act (FDCPA), and Telephone Consumer Protection Act (TCPA).

Jake provides ongoing analysis and commentary on developments in the consumer financial services industry through the CFS Law Monitor blog.
